Nadaprabhu Sri Kempegowda

The Vice-President pays tributes to Nadaprabhu Sri Kempegowda on his 517th birth anniversary in Bengaluru. The news highlights Kempegowda’s role as a 16th-century chieftain under the Vijayanagara Empire and his association with founding Bengaluru.

Nadaprabhu Sri Kempegowda :

Dimension Key Details
Identity and Polity He is a 16th-century chieftain under the Vijayanagara Empire.
Birth and Death He is born in 1510 and dies in 1569.
Founding of Bengaluru He founds Bengaluru in 1537.
Authority and Permission He obtains permission from Vijayanagara Emperor Achyuta Devaraya to build the Bengaluru Fort.
Capital Shift He shifts his capital from Yelahanka to the new Bengaluru Pete.
Pete (Definition) Pete comprises the historic, foundational heart of Bengaluru (Bangalore).
Urban Planning He builds a mud fort with four watchtowers marking the city’s boundaries.
Infrastructure and Water Management He establishes lakes, tanks, and temples, and promotes irrigation and water management.
Governance Measures He introduces revenue collection systems and administrative reforms under Vijayanagara patronage.
Social Reform He is credited with abolishing the practice among the Morasu Vokkaligas community where unmarried women had to amputate the last two fingers of their left hand during the Bandi Devaru custom.
Cultural Patronage He strengthens Kannada identity by encouraging arts, literature, and local traditions.
Social Vision He promotes inclusive development, integrating agrarian communities with urban settlements.
Recognition (Statue of Prosperity) The Statue of Prosperity comprises a 108-foot bronze statue of Kempe Gowda located at Kempe Gowda International Airport, Bangalore, Karnataka.
Commemoration Commemoration comprises the naming of Kempe Gowda International Airport and the institution of the Kempe Gowda Award.
